Axochiapan in Spring
In spring (March, April and May), Axochiapan sees average daytime highs around 35°C and overnight lows near 20°C, with 62 mm of rain over about 14 wet days across the season. It is the warmest season of the year and the 3rd-wettest season.
Across spring, daytime highs hold fairly steady around 35°C.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 61% of the time across spring, and the air most often feels dry.

Temperature in Axochiapan in Spring
Across spring, daytime highs hold fairly steady around 35°C.
A typical spring day in Axochiapan reaches about 35°C and drops to 20°C overnight. The warmest of the three months is April, the coolest March.

Axochiapan weather by month
How the three spring months (March, April and May) compare with the rest of the year — the season's months are highlighted.
| Month | High / Low (°C) | Rainfall (mm) | Wet days | Daylight (hours) | Travel score |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Jan | 29° / 15° | 5 | 0.8 | 11 | 6.9 |
| Feb | 31° / 16° | 4 | 0.7 | 11.4 | 5.7 |
| Mar | 34° / 19° | 5 | 1.4 | 11.9 | 4.2 |
| Apr | 35° / 21° | 8 | 2 | 12.4 | 2.8 |
| May | 35° / 22° | 49 | 10.1 | 12.9 | 2.5 |
| Jun | 32° / 21° | 183 | 19.5 | 13.1 | 3.0 |
| Jul | 32° / 20° | 142 | 17 | 13 | 3.4 |
| Aug | 32° / 20° | 178 | 19.9 | 12.6 | 3.2 |
| Sep | 30° / 20° | 213 | 22.1 | 12.1 | 3.5 |
| Oct | 31° / 19° | 81 | 11.3 | 11.6 | 4.6 |
| Nov | 31° / 17° | 13 | 2.7 | 11.1 | 5.6 |
| Dec | 30° / 15° | 3 | 0.6 | 10.9 | 6.7 |

Sunrise & sunset in Spring
Daylight runs from about 11 h 36 min in early March to 13 hours by late May. The lit band spans sunrise to sunset each day.

UV index in Axochiapan in Spring
Clear-sky midday UV across spring averages around 12 (very high — sun protection essential). The full-year curve, shaded by WHO exposure level, is below.
Under clear skies, the midday UV index in Axochiapan peaks around April 11 at about 13 (extreme) — sunscreen, a hat and midday shade are essential. It bottoms out near December 15 at about 7 (very high).
The index reaches 3 or more — the level where the WHO recommends sun protection — every month of the year.
| Jan | Feb | Mar | Apr | May | Jun | Jul | Aug | Sep | Oct | Nov | Dec |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| UV index (midday) | 9 | 11 | 13 | 13 | 9 | 12 | 12 | 13 | 12 | 10 | 8 | 7 |
| Level | Very high | Extreme | Extreme | Extreme | Very high | Extreme | Extreme | Extreme | Extreme | Very high | Very high | Very high |

Air quality in Axochiapan in Spring
Average fine-particle pollution (PM2.5) through the year — so you can see where spring falls, not just the annual average.
Air quality in Axochiapan is worst in November — around 103 µg/m³ PM2.5 (unhealthy), about 1.8× the cleanest month (April, 57 µg/m³).
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).
| Jan | Feb | Mar | Apr | May | Jun | Jul | Aug | Sep | Oct | Nov | Dec |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| PM2.5 (µg/m³) | 79 | 70 | 58 | 57 | 78 | 69 | 69 | 70 | 82 | 90 | 103 | 101 |
| Level | Unhealthy | Unhealthy | Unhealthy | Unhealthy | Unhealthy | Unhealthy | Unhealthy | Unhealthy | Unhealthy | Unhealthy | Unhealthy | Unhealthy |

Where is Axochiapan?
Axochiapan sits at 18.5°N, 98.8°W, 1,039 m above sea level, in Mexico. The nearest listed city is Izúcar de Matamoros, 33 km away.
Topography around Axochiapan
How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Axochiapan.
Within 3 km, the terrain around Axochiapan has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 108 m around an average of 1,029 m above sea level; within 16 km, large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 904 m; within 80 km, extreme vari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 4,835 m.
The land around Axochiapan is covered by cropland (52%) within 3 km, trees (39%), cropland (30%) and shrubs (20%) within 16 km, and shrubs (41%) and trees (36%) within 80 km.
